Receiving healthcare from an _______ facility may mean higher costs in the form of co-pays or deductibles.
Out-of-network. Obtaining healthcare from providers or hospitals out of your health insurance network may be more expensive.

The size of subsidies under the Affordable Care Act depend upon _______.
Your family's income and size. The amount of subsidy will depend on these two factors.

With a bronze or silver health insurance plan, premiums are likely to be _______ those of a gold or platinum plan.
Lower than. Bronze and silver plans have higher deductibles and out-of-pocket maximums than gold and platinum plans with lower premiums.

What is one of the costs to society of millions of people not having health insurance?
Hospitals going out of business. When patients don't have health insurance, hospitals have less revenue and may reach the point where they go out of business.

Children up to age _______ may be covered by the federal Children's Health Insurance Program (CHIP).
19. However, their eligibility is ultimately dependent on income and what state they live in.
